Aireborough Rotary's Charter Evening at Horsforth Golf Club LS18 5EX

Tue, Oct 28th 2025 at 6:30 pm - 10:00 pm

President Alicia Ridout celebrated Aireborough's 72nd Charter in fine style with members and guests but because of a mix-up in dates took in her stride giving the presentation about her Charity of the Year Leeds Carers

President Alicia with Sapphire PHF Graham Davies

More than 70 members and guests attended including a variety of Clubs including Adventurers, Ilkley, Leeds, Otley, Aireborough Inner Wheel, Bradford West and Bingley Airedale. President Elect Mark Whitfield brought humour to both his self penned grace and his individualised greetings to members from neighbouring Clubs. Highlight of the evening was the Presentation of a second Paul Harris Fellowship Award - this time a sapphire - to Club stalwart Graham Davies.                                 

 I am delighted this evening to make this presentation to a multi talented Aireborough Rotarian who contributes in equal measure to both the Club and our wider community. He joined the Club 15 years ago following in his grandfather’s footsteps, his personality added to his business acumen soon made him an invaluable member. Once a fundraising event was over he could be relied upon to present us all in quick time with a printout of the successful outcome.

As an organiser he joined or established working groups for the Beer Festival, the Easter Egg Hunt and the Brass Band Concert with rotas a speciality. On the days he would be always in the thick of it, leading from the front and putting his scouting skills to good purpose where gazebos were concerned

Eventually and relatively early he found his niche as Club Secretary stretching the normal five years to seven supporting a succession of Presidents and always having the answers when queries arose. No member could ever complain that they were not well informed; the problem was many found it difficult to keep up! A lively Club, Aireborough has no shortage of wits, he soon fitted in and joined the competition.

Within the Aireborough Community he volunteers at the Grove Methodist Church’s Tots and Tykes Club, spends his Monday evenings on food pantry collections at supermarkets and is a member of a patient panel at Golden Bank Surgery. Together with his wife, he is a blood donor.
